Core Viewpoint - The global industry consensus is that large-scale array technology will be the core direction of 6G network architecture, with ZTE leading the evolution path through its comprehensive technological layout [1][10]. Group 1: Technological Innovation - ZTE has successfully built a theoretical system for large-scale array mobile communication, achieving a generational leap from traditional "spectrum rolling" to "space expansion" [2]. - The company introduced the Pre5G concept based on Massive MIMO at the 2014 5G World Summit, which garnered significant attention in the industry [2]. - ZTE's Pre5G Massive MIMO base station won the "Best Mobile Technology Breakthrough Award" and "CTO Choice Award" at the 2016 Global Mobile Awards, marking it as the first Chinese company to receive such honors [2]. Group 2: Market Recognition - ZTE's large-scale array base station shipments have ranked among the top globally for three consecutive years, with a market share of 30% in the Asia-Pacific region [3]. - The introduction of the world's first 64-channel large-scale array base station during the Pre5G phase significantly enhanced peak capacity by over 10 times [5]. - ZTE's self-developed vector acceleration chip improved parallel processing capability by 32 times, leading to significantly better energy efficiency compared to 4G [5]. Group 3: Energy Efficiency - ZTE's 5G network based on 64-channel arrays has reduced energy consumption per bit by nearly 90% compared to 4G [6]. - Approximately 30% of ZTE's nearly 7000 essential 5G standard patents focus on green energy-saving technologies [6]. Group 4: Industry Value - ZTE has fostered collaborative innovation with over a thousand upstream and downstream enterprises, training more than ten thousand professionals [7]. - The technological advancements have provided reliable communication support for major national events, such as the Beijing Winter Olympics, and have driven the overall upgrade of China's communication industry [7]. Group 5: Future Outlook - ZTE is actively promoting research for 6G, proposing the industry's first large-scale array prototype with over 2000 oscillators in the 6425-7125 MHz frequency band [8]. - The company is extending its large-scale array technology advantages to the emerging low-altitude economy, launching a user-centric 5G-A distributed ultra-large array (D3-ELAA) solution [8]. - The D3-ELAA solution effectively addresses issues such as severe interference and frequent switching in low-altitude communication, creating a high-reliability communication foundation for the low-altitude economy [8].
